TIPS Incorporated provides a 90-minute online restaurant training course and certification to individuals transitioning into the workforce. Restaurant work can be ideal for women re-entering the workforce since it provides daily money in the form of gratuities and builds self-sufficiency. TIPS certification helps build life skills and resumes. TIPS also provides vocational training to survivors of domestic violence.
Started in 2007

Who is helped?

Women transitioning in to the workforce. Capacity: Unlimited.
